7 Am Samstag, 6. Mai 2017, 18:35:08 CEST schrieb Michał Górny:
8 > 1. I think your example is a bit misleading -- unless I'm missing
9 > something, mips would be 'unstable' right now, and m68k would be
10 > 'testing'.
11
12 Fixed.
13
14 > 2. I can't say I like using magical keywords like 'testing'
15 > and 'unstable'; they're going to be confusing long-term
16 > I should point out that those terms are frequently used interchangeably,
17 > and adding disjoint meanings to them is least misleading. Perhaps a name
18 > like 'transitional' for the middle state would be better?
19
20 I replaced "testing" with "mixed". So now the three values are "stable",
21 "mixed", "unstable". I think that should be more clear.
22
23 > 3. What is the use case for 'broken'? Are we ever going to use that?
24
25 I don't really know of any, so I've removed this again.
26
27 > Rationale is 'why did I
28 > choose this specific solution?' -- e.g. choice of file format, keywords
29 > and basically answers to every useful question that has been raised.
30
31 Added, though I'm not sure it's really complete.
32
33 > > a. whether CI should enforce correct depgraph and how,
34 >
35 > Well, my approach for this would be that CI should enforce the same things
36 > as
37 > Repoman.
38
39 Changed the wording such that it's not repoman-specific anymore.
40
41
42 > > b. whether we should request stabilizing packages.
43 >
44 > We could, however, add one more column *only* for the (testing) mixed case,
45 > which states whether stabilization requests are required.
46
47 Implemented this, now we have a third column. That makes the specs a bit more
48 complex, but it's probably worth it. And the third column will nearly always
49 be empty.
